Taylor Swift is a name that resonates with millions of music lovers worldwide. From her country roots to her pop superstardom, Swift’s musical journey is a testament to her talent, hard work, and connection with fans. This post will explore the life, music, and impact of Taylor Swift.
Early Life and Career
Born on December 13, 1989, in Reading, Pennsylvania, Taylor Swift showed a passion for music at a young age. She moved to Nashville at the age of 14 to pursue a career in country music and quickly made a name for herself with her self-titled debut album.
Transition to Pop
While Swift started in country music, she seamlessly transitioned to pop with her album “1989.” The album was a commercial success and marked a new era in Swift’s career, showcasing her versatility as an artist.
Songwriting and Themes
One of the hallmarks of Swift’s music is her songwriting. She often draws from personal experiences, creating songs that resonate with her listeners. Themes of love, heartbreak, and personal growth are prevalent in her music.
Impact and Influence
Swift’s impact on the music industry is undeniable. With numerous awards and record-breaking albums, she has cemented her place as one of the most influential artists of her generation.
